Welcome to Micron’s Scribe Design Group! We are a group of engineers who design specific Test Structures that provide electrical and physical information to process development and manufacturing teams. You will be involved from the design to final testing of semiconductor devices that will be used to monitor and improve the process window of all Micron products. You will be working with various tools and techniques to provide decision making information to our customers. You will have the opportunity to participate and to collaborate in a group project, together with other interns and engineers, to find solutions spanning from device design conception to final data analysis.

As an intern, your responsibility includes, but is not limited to:

Develop and document new methods to optimize test structure designs to be recorded as Design-Of-Record. Define Best Known Method based on your learning, and to detail the thought process and the supporting data. Build a strategy to automate the collection of both physical and electrical verifications. Improve visibility of electrical metrics and compare results to defined targets. Build automated scripts and/or program to organize information into visual results that give insight to the status of Test Structures based on physical and electrical results. Work on a hands-on and collaborative project to understand and optimize OPC, DFM, CMP impact on Test Structures and include findings in Design-Of-Record document. Identify potential opportunities of improvement, including areas which can be challenging to achieve during the internship period. Contribute in a multidisciplinary project of Micron’s Mask Technology group
